Toys & Chews.
While many kennels and daycares will certainly have playthings offered for your dog, it's constantly a great concept to bring your own. Look for playthings that are durable and made from non-toxic products. Likewise, select chew playthings that are appropriate for your pet dog's size, age and eating routines. For example, if your pet is an uncontrollable chewer, prevent plastic toys that can splinter. Rather, attempt Kong-type toys that can be stuffed with peanut butter, cheese or deals with.
Likewise, choose durable chews like rawhide or oral chews (such as Virbac C.E.T Enzymatic Hygiene Chews). These aid eliminate plaque and tartar from your animal's teeth as they chew. The chews must be small adequate to not present a risk of choking or digestive tract obstructions, and must be very easy for your animal to absorb.
Food & Treats.
Equally as parents wouldn't send their youngsters to institution without a lunch and book bag, pets must be prepared to go to daycare with the ideal supplies. This includes any kind of food or treats your canine may need during their keep (if they comply with a special diet) and medicine, if needed.
Keep in mind that high-value treats need to be fed sparingly and accounted for in your family pet's daily calories. A few of their favored toys or packed animals can be reassuring and aid with the shift to a brand-new atmosphere.
Be sure to bring your pet's routine food, as abrupt changes in diet plan can lead to indigestions, gas and looseness of the bowels. Labeling your pet dog's meals in different plastic bags can make feeding times much easier for team and also make certain that your puppy receives the right amount of food daily.
